About Sutejirō
Sutejirō is a name deeply rooted in Japanese tradition, carrying a distinct historical weight that feels both poignant and fascinating. While its literal meaning, "to abandon" or "to throw away," might initially give pause, this name was historically often given to foundlings or children whose parents wished to ward off evil spirits by feigning abandonment. This practice imbued Sutejirō with a protective, almost defiant spirit, making it a choice for parents who appreciate names with a rich, complex narrative and a connection to ancient cultural practices. It’s a name that speaks to resilience and a unique heritage, far from the modern trend of purely aesthetic choices.
